&lt;/embed&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;AIBO’s personality develops by interactingwith people and each AIBO grows in a different way, based on its individualexperiences. AIBO becomes customizedbased on feedback and the software being used.With supplied AIBO MIND autonomous software, you can immediately interact with a mature ERS-7 or you can also reset it to its puppy stage.&lt;br /&gt;AIBO’s mood changes with its environment, and its mood affects its behavior. AIBO also has instincts to move around, to look for its toys, to satisfy its curiosity, to play and communicate with its owner, to recharge when its battery is low, and to wake up when its done sleeping.&lt;br /&gt;AIBO is capable of six feelings - happiness, sadness, fear, dislike, surprise, and anger. Its unique personality is developed with a combination of theseunique instincts and feelings.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The more you interact with ERS-7, the more it learns. &l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;br /&gt;AIBO’s skill level can improve through encouragement from its owner. By praising AIBO for kicking the ball well, it will continue to play with the ball. Repeated practice with the ball will improve its skill level and it will learn new tricks. If you scold AIBO for playing with its ball, it will stop showing as much interest in it. With AIBO's back sensors, it is possible to adjust AIBO's schedule to coincide with your daily routine. You can schedule your usual bed time and AIBO will go to sleep on its charging station until it's time to get up. AIBO can also use its alarm to wake you up in the morning.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The more you interact with ERS-7, the more it learns. The Script Call Back is binded to a trigger .When the trigger is instantiated it  uses a COM object to issue an HTTP POST or GET command to the specified target URL. The COM object used here is an old acquaintance of many developers:&lt;br /&gt;var xmlRequest = new ActiveXObject("Microsoft.XMLHTTP");&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Once the request is made to the server,the server calls the appropriate method,sends the result and the browser can change the UI of the current page using DHTML to reflect the results/changes.&lt;br /&gt;Check it out at&lt;br /&gt;&lt;a href="http://msdn.microsoft.com/msdnmag/issues/04/08/CuttingEdge/"&gt;http://msdn.microsoft.com/msdnmag/issues/04/08/CuttingEdge/&lt;/a&gt;&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/7149482-111208984656529508?l=salmanblog.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://salmanblog.blogspot.com/feeds/111208984656529508/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=7149482&amp;postID=111208984656529508' title='1 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/7149482/posts/default/111208984656529508'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/7149482/posts/default/111208984656529508'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://salmanblog.blogspot.com/2005/03/get-ready-for-script-callbacks-in.html' title='Get Ready for Script CallBacks in ASP.NET 2.0'/><author><name>Muhammad Salman Mehmood</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/00459112701934291989</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='18' height='32' src='http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_hgUQMH_8nnA/SWwL9wsbCLI/AAAAAAAABHA/A6rX2vHFbpk/S220/mypic.jpg'/></author><thr:total>1</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-7149482.post-111208370004517150</id><published>2005-03-28T23:44:00.002-08:00</published><updated>2005-03-29T00:58:24.120-08:00</updated><title type='text'>A First Look at the CMS Designer</title><content type='html'>After three weeks of hectic work the CMS Designer has finally entered the testing stage of the third iteration.By now we have numerous features in place.Just to introduce ,the CMS Desginer is basically the core of the NGCMS Next Generation Content Management System , im currently working on.We know content management systems in the past were simply more of the document management systems,and the only customization they provided was in the form of raw html that the user would end up manipulating .
